Port Facilities,  Security, Legal and  Consultancy Services Directorate  

Vision
To gain recognition of security, safety, environment and health as a cornerstone of our modern maritime and Logistics Zones industry, and with that safety and security that matchup the best international standards.

Mission Statement
To maintain GOP position as an international – class organisation for its maritime and logistics zone, through implementing national and international HSSE standard.

Goals

  1. Commitment to satisfy the requirements of our stake holders at large.
     
  2. Applying the concept of modern HSSE management, to the Directorate through (QMS) Quality Management System.
     
  3. Improve Supply Chain Management, through quality movement of containers, without jeopardizing supply chain effectiveness.
     
  4. The introduction of GOP HSSE code.
     
  5. To regulate and enforce minimum requirements and Criteria to operating companies and its HSSE personnel serving GOP facilities.
     
  6. To provide an internal legal frame work through codes, instructions and guidelines as a regulatory body to stake holders.
     
  7. Subject to GOP Law RD No. (61) 2006, Article (20) and RD No. (15) 1976 Sanction Law, In the event of breach to the HSSE code, to caution and issue penalties by the method of points and monetary fine against offenders.
     
  8. To continuously monitor HSSE status at GOP facilities and to modify our policy or implement any additional national or international standard.
     
  9. Communicate our quality, HSSE policy to stakeholders.
     
  10. Consider the Directorate as a value added consultative service for Port HSSE issues.
     
  11. Change & create a new culture to HSSE ownership beyond the Port Facilities, Security, Legal and Consultancy Services Directorate.
     
  12. Develop high-impact HSSE Port Training Policy System.
     
  13. To strengthen existing joint co-operation with local ministries, inter-governmental agencies, regarding SSEH policies at GOP facilities.
 
DSA Functions
 

Port Facilities Security Unit:

  1. In line with SOLAS Chapter XI-2 & ISPS Code to supervise the development and maintenance of ports facilities security assessment (PFSA) and ports facilities security plans (PFSP) in GOP ports facilities, which meets the requirement of the ISPS code and HSSE code.
     
  2. To establish ports security committee, comprising representatives of interested parties within the GOP facilities.
     
  3. Provide an up to date best practice and information on current security development and on the implementation of the ports security plans and where necessary, coordinate and test the overall ports response to security incident by conducting regular drills.
     
  4. Ensure the effective management and responding of internal security arrangement in order to meet the requirements of GOP ports security plans.
     
  5. To coordinate and improve national initiatives to deter and prevent maritime terrorist actions.
     
  6. To establish a general ports security strategy plan.
     
  7. To establish general ports security measures to GOP facilities not covered by the ISPS code.
     
  8. Decide and enforce standard accountable to the costs for GOP ports, to improve security measures and the consequences of security failures.
     
  9. To ensure that the risks to GOP stake holders from such illegal act are deterred by best practice.
     
  10. Reporting security incidents to concerned authorities.
     
  11. Liaise with operating companies, inter governmental Agencies, and Ministries, defence attaché of foreign embassies regarding;
    a. Exchange of security (credible) information.
    b. Visits of friendly warships.
    c. Visits of VIPs to GOP facilities.
    d. Representing the GOP in any matter related to security.


Licensing Unit:

  1. As per HSSE criteria – a compulsory licensing of individuals working in a specific HSSE duties within GOP facilities.
     
  2. As per HSSE criteria to issue licenses to :
    - HSSE Management.
    - Safety & Health Officers.
    - Crane Operators
    - Lifting Plant Operator.
    - Security Officers.
    - Security Guards.
    - Other SSE & H duties.
     
  3. Provide guidance to training providers and employers after implementing the HSSE Code concerning Training Policy.
     
  4. License holders should be able to provide evidence to support their training strategy and how it is to be implemented and audited when questioned by inspectors as part of routine inspections and at license assessment interviews.

Security, Safety, Environment and Healthy Inspection Unit:-

  1. To observe HSSE personnel and lifting plants operators' performance and their management and operational main duties; this should be performed in accordance with the minimum HSSE code requirements.
     
  2. To ensure that the risks to employees, customer's health and safety from work activities are controlled properly, by providing advice and guidance on how to comply with the HSSE code.
     
  3. To observe security personnel and operating companies management and operational response to HSSE code requirements.

  4. To supervise lifting plants testing, Inspecting lifting plants, general machineries general safety, health and environmental arrangements at GOP facilities.

  5. Supervise testing and inspecting security equipments.

  6. To caution and issue penalties by the method of points and monetary fines against any offenders to the HSSE code entering GOP facilities.

  7. Investigating and surveying fatal occupational accidents & Injuries in different GOP facilities, followed by written technical reports needed.

  8. Studying and responding to questionnaires and studies related to port occupational Safety Environment & Health field in co-ordination with other governmental agencies.
     
  9. Studying and developing port HSSE Policy.

  10. Providing Bahraini Courts (included within the Ministry of Justice) with technical testimonies performing as a witness for Public prosecution in the cases raised and related to port accidents and injuries.
     
  11. Strengthen existing joint co-operation with Ministry of The Interior, Ministry of Health, Ministry of Labor, CREWL & other inter-governmental agencies, with regard to any HSSE issue at GOP facilities.
